当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

如何将java部署到云服务器上,Java应用程序部署到云服务器全攻略,从环境搭建到上线实战

如何将java部署到云服务器上,Java应用程序部署到云服务器全攻略,从环境搭建到上线实战

本文全面解析Java应用程序部署到云服务器的全过程,涵盖环境搭建、配置优化、安全设置、上线实战等关键步骤,助您轻松将Java应用部署到云端。...

本文全面解析Java应用程序部署到云服务器的全过程,涵盖环境搭建、配置优化、安全设置、上线实战等关键步骤,助您轻松将Java应用部署到云端。

随着云计算技术的不断发展,越来越多的企业选择将Java应用程序部署到云服务器上,以提高系统的稳定性和可扩展性,本文将详细讲解如何将Java应用程序部署到云服务器上,包括环境搭建、应用打包、部署上线等步骤。

准备工作

1、选择云服务器:我们需要选择一款适合的云服务器,目前市面上主流的云服务器有阿里云、腾讯云、华为云等,根据个人需求选择合适的云服务器类型和配置。

如何将java部署到云服务器上,Java应用程序部署到云服务器全攻略,从环境搭建到上线实战

2、云服务器登录:登录云服务器,进行基本的系统配置,确保服务器可以正常访问互联网,以便后续操作。

3、安装Java环境:在云服务器上安装Java环境,可以使用官方的JDK包进行安装,以下是安装步骤:

(1)下载JDK安装包:从Oracle官网下载JDK安装包,选择与云服务器操作系统相匹配的版本。

(2)上传JDK安装包:使用FTP、SCP或直接上传到云服务器。

(3)解压JDK安装包:在云服务器上解压JDK安装包。

(4)配置环境变量:编辑~/.bashrc文件,添加以下内容:

export JAVA_HOME=/usr/local/jdk1.8.0_251
export PATH=$PATH:$JAVA_HOME/bin

(5)使环境变量生效:执行以下命令使环境变量生效:

source ~/.bashrc

4、安装Maven:Maven是Java项目构建和管理工具,用于依赖管理和构建项目,以下是安装步骤:

(1)下载Maven安装包:从Apache官网下载Maven安装包。

(2)上传Maven安装包:使用FTP、SCP或直接上传到云服务器。

如何将java部署到云服务器上,Java应用程序部署到云服务器全攻略,从环境搭建到上线实战

(3)解压Maven安装包:在云服务器上解压Maven安装包。

(4)配置环境变量:编辑~/.bashrc文件,添加以下内容:

export MAVEN_HOME=/usr/local/maven
export PATH=$PATH:$MAVEN_HOME/bin

(5)使环境变量生效:执行以下命令使环境变量生效:

source ~/.bashrc

5、安装数据库:根据项目需求,安装相应的数据库,如MySQL、Oracle等。

应用打包

1、编写Java应用程序:使用IDE(如IntelliJ IDEA、Eclipse等)编写Java应用程序。

2、添加依赖:在项目根目录下的pom.xml文件中添加项目所需的依赖。

3、构建项目:在命令行中执行以下命令构建项目:

mvn clean install

4、打包项目:执行以下命令将项目打包为war包:

mvn war:war

部署上线

1、上传war包:将生成的war包上传到云服务器。

2、部署war包:在云服务器上创建一个新的web应用,将war包上传到该应用的部署目录下。

如何将java部署到云服务器上,Java应用程序部署到云服务器全攻略,从环境搭建到上线实战

3、启动web应用:启动云服务器上的web应用,如使用Tomcat。

4、验证部署:在浏览器中输入云服务器的IP地址和端口号,查看Java应用程序是否正常运行。

本文详细讲解了如何将Java应用程序部署到云服务器上,通过以上步骤,您可以将Java应用程序部署到云服务器,实现高可用性和可扩展性,在实际部署过程中,还需注意以下几点:

1、确保云服务器安全:定期更新系统、关闭不必要的端口、设置强密码等。

2、监控应用性能:使用云服务提供商提供的监控工具,实时监控应用性能。

3、持续优化:根据业务需求,持续优化Java应用程序和云服务器配置。

希望本文对您有所帮助,祝您部署成功!

黑狐家游戏

发表评论

最新文章